Comprehending Double Glazed Doors
Double glazed doors include two panes of glass with a sealed airspace in between. This style uses various advantages:
Insulation: Reduces heat loss in winter and keeps interiors cool in summer season.Sound Reduction: Minimizes external sound intrusions.Security: Reinforced glass building and construction enhances security.UV Protection: Protects furnishings and flooring from sun damage.
In spite of these advantages, double glazed doors can experience issues that need expert or DIY repair.
Common Issues with Double Glazed Doors
A number of issues can affect double glazed doors. Here are some common issues house owners might deal with:
ProblemDescriptionSeal FailureThe sealing in between the panes may degrade, resulting in condensation.MisalignmentDoors might become misaligned in time, impacting their operation.Hardware MalfunctionLocksets, hinges, and manages can break or break.Fogging Between PanesMoisture trapped in between panes can trigger visibility issues.Fractures or ChipsDamage to the glass can jeopardize security and looks.Detailed Insights into Common Problems
Seal Failure: One of the most prevalent issues is the failure of the sealant that holds the 2 glass panes together. Gradually, weather changes can deteriorate these seals, permitting air moisture to infiltrate and mist the glass.

Misalignment: With regular use, double glazed doors might move from their initial position. This misalignment might trigger trouble when opening or closing the door, leading to potential security risks.

Hardware Malfunction: Components such as locks and hinges go through routine wear. Broken or malfunctioning hardware can compromise door security and function.

Misting Between Panes: When the seal stops working, humidity and temperature modifications can cause fogging, making the door look unattractive and minimizing visibility.

Fractures or Chips: External forces, such as effects from storms or items, can result in glass damage. Such problems not only ruin the door's look but can likewise pose safety threats.
Repairing Double Glazed Doors
Repairing double glazed doors can generally be classified into two main techniques: DIY repairs and expert intervention. Depending on the issue, the following steps can guide property owners through the repair process.
DIY Repair Techniques
Replacing Seals:
Tools Needed: Utility knife, brand-new sealant, silicone caulk gun.Steps:Remove existing seals with an utility knife.Clean the area completely.Use new sealant evenly, ensuring an airtight fit.
Straightening Doors:
Tools Needed: Screwdriver, level.Actions:Check the positioning with a level.Loosen up the screws in the hinges and change for alignment.Tighten screws when properly lined up.
Altering Hardware:
Tools Needed: Drill, screwdriver, new hardware.Steps:Remove the inefficient hardware carefully.Install new parts according to manufacturer directions.Professional Repair Techniques
For considerable issues such as fogging or serious cracks, professional intervention is recommended due to safety and competence concerns.

Glass Replacement:
In cases of significant fractures or fogging, professionals can replace the glass unit while maintaining the existing frame.
Seal Replacement:
Experts can quickly and effectively replace faulty seals utilizing specialized tools and materials.
Complete Door Replacement:
If the door is beyond repair, specialists can evaluate and recommend a total door replacement, which may improve your home's energy effectiveness.Preventative Measures

How can I tell if my double glazed door needs repair?
Typical indications include condensation between the panes, difficulty in opening/closing, visible drafts, or if the door has cracks.
2. Can I repair double glazed doors myself?
Numerous minor repairs can be dealt with by homeowners with fundamental tools and abilities, but substantial concerns like glass replacement are best left to experts.
3. For how long do double glazed doors last?
Typically, double glazed doors can last between 15 to 30 years, depending upon maintenance and exposure to extreme weather condition conditions.
4. Is it worth repairing a double glazed door?
If the structural integrity and insulation abilities of the door are undamaged, repairing rather than changing can be an economical solution.
5. What is the expense of double glazed door repair?
Repair expenses can differ extensively based on the concern. Small repairs may range from ₤ 100 to ₤ 200, while glass replacement might cost a number of hundred dollars or more.
